12V Storage Battery: How Much Energy is Available for Powering Appliances?
A 12-volt battery with a capacity of 500 amp-hours (Ah) stores energy. You calculate it by multiplying 500 Ah by 12 V. This equals 6,000 watt-hours (Wh) or 6 kilowatt-hours (kWh).
